Harnessing Top Cloud Providers: Choosing the Right Approach for You
The cloud computing landscape is continuously evolving, presenting businesses with a plethora of alternatives. Selecting the suitable cloud provider can be a daunting process, requiring careful consideration of your specific needs and goals.
, To begin with, it's essential to outline your business objectives. What are you seeking to achieve through cloud implementation? Are you concentrated on expense reduction, scalability, or enhanced protection?
Once your objectives are clear, you can begin researching the renowned cloud providers. Some of the most prominent names in the industry include Amazon Web Services (AWS), Microsoft Azure, and Google Cloud Platform (GCP). Each provider presents a unique portfolio of services, pricing models, and capabilities.
Thoroughly assess the strengths and limitations of each provider in relation to your specific demands. Don't hesitate to consult industry experts or perform a proof-of-concept to establish the best alignment for your business.
